Welcome to the Parslane platform. Our config service hot-reloads any file under `settings/live/` every ten seconds, so never restart the daemon manually—just save your edits and verify via the status endpoint. Before testing reload behavior locally, point your instance at the sandbox database using the connection string below.

replica DSN, kajep-yahag: mssql://praok_svc:iF@db-8d68.plorvaio.local:5432/eliion

**Mgmt Meeting Minutes — Retiring the Brightline Range**

Quick recap for sales leads at Fenholt Supplies: we agreed to retire the Brightline fixture range by year-end. Remaining stock moves to clearance pricing next month, and accounts on standing orders get migrated to the Lumetta range. Trade-in incentives were approved in principle. The confidential note on next steps sits just below.

board note of bajof-bajeg: The pricing group signed off on a budget of $13.4 million for Project Sildor. The renewal with Lamixek Holdings closes at $48.9 million a year, 49 percent above the last contract.

Audit item 14: Session-token refresh bug (Parloft Gateway). Confirm the fix for the double-refresh race is still in place: concurrent refresh requests must coalesce on the per-session mutex introduced in release 4.7, and stale tokens must be rejected within the 30-second grace window. Verify the regression test suite covers the Westhollow reproduction case, including the mobile client retry path. If either check fails, halt the audit and escalate. The accountable engineer for this item, who must countersign the findings, is named below.

account owner for bawip-tahag: Raleth Quenok